Remember, once you've identified a good machinist, HE is the expert - not you - so let him do his job. It is important that you communicate clearly with the machinist and provide FACTORY SPECS (leave your books with them or give them my contact info), as opposed to numbers or theories you've come up with on your own, but don't try to reinvent the wheel. Don't try to prove Toyota wrong (they're not) or tell the machinist that he should do things your way if you're still learning the right way yourself. Don't tell him what to do so much as tell them what your goals are.
You have sort of been trying to extrapolate, assume, chisel, and sledgehammer your way through some very specific, very precise procedures. It just ain't gonna work. It took me some time to learn that lesson myself, but I assure you, it is quite valid.
